Transaction da403aedfe8916bf78960efdf7aed9247dd2674107681b8c2089f86e865c3b1e

block
4b7ef03cfa10f000261dc69e9354d30b8c45c0919c0d1727963d79e59752813b

1 Input

81 Outputs